This lesson is concerned with the different ways of identifying and manipulating. The dom is an api for accessing and manipulatingin particular, html and xml documents. Document object model dom world wide web consortium. In the introduction to the dom, we went over what the document object model. The w3c document object model dom is a platform and languageneutral interface that allows programs and scripts to dynamically access and update the content, structure, and style of a document. The dom is extremely useful for randomaccess applications. Excel object model for visual basic for applications vba. The document object model dom is a crossplatform and language independent interface. Dom represents each node of the xml tree as an object with properties and behavior for processing the xml. The w3c document object model dom is a platform and languageneutral interface that allows programs and scripts to dynamically access and update the. The root node is documentcore class, which is represent a document itself. Lets see the properties of document object that can be accessed and modified by the document object. Use the table of contents in the left navigation to view the topics in this section. Document object model tutorial computer tutorials in pdf.
The document object model, usually referred to as the dom, is an essential part of making websites interactive. The document object model is not represented by set of data structures. This section of the excel vba reference contains documentation for all the objects, properties, methods, and events contained in the excel object model. An introduction to the dom document object model in. Get to know the object model because vba is an object oriented language, you will be most effective if you understand the word object model and how to manipulate it. The browser itself has a long list of objects including. To introduce document manipulation with the xml document object model, a simple scripting example that uses javascript and microsofts msxml parser is introduced. The document object model dom is an application programming interface api for valid html. Chapter 10 document object model and dynamic html thetermdynamichtml,oftenabbreviatedasdhtml,referstothetechniqueofmaking webpagesdynamicbyclient. Javascript tutorial document object model dom youtube. The document object model dom is the data representation of the objects that comprise the structure and content of a document on the web.
The invoice document is created with the migradoc document object model. Take advantage of this course called document object model tutorial to improve your web development skills and better understand dom. It defines a standard for accessing documents like html and xml. Thus, an impedance mismatch exists between the way databases view application data and how the application wishes to manipulate that data. In this part we will talk about what the javascript dom document object model is and we will look at the different selectors like document.
Now that you know what objects are,let me tell you something that will expandyour perception of objects significantly. Javascript is the clientside scripting language that connects to the dom in an internet browser. It has attributes on it that model elements on the page. The html document object model dom is a w3c standard that defines a set of html objects and their methods and properties.
This example takes an xml document example 2 that marks up an article and uses the dom api to display the documents. Hey gang, welcome to your very first javascript dom tutorial. Javascript document object model or dom tutorialspoint. Each html document that gets loaded into a window becomes a document object. A dom is a standard tree structure, where each node contains one of the components from an xml structure. The document object model dom is a programming api for html and xml documents.
An introduction to objectoriented databases and database. According to w3c the w3c document object model dom is a platform and languageneutral interface that allows programs and scripts to dynamically access and update the content, structure, and style of a document.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. Definition of dom as put by the w3c is the document object model dom is an application programming interface api for html and xml documents. It explains the basics of sketcher usage, and goes into a lot of detail about the creation of geometrical shapes, and each of the constraints. The document object model dom is a programming interface for html and xmlextensible markup language documents. The dom model is created as a tree of objects like this. The html dom is a standard object model and programming interface for html. The html dom model is constructed as a tree of objects.
The dom document object model standard was put forth by w3cworld wide web consortium for browser companies and web developers to follow. The dom is often referred to as the dom tree, and consists of a tree of objects called nodes. A complete, unsorted list of tutorials can be found in category. The html dom tree with a programmable object model, javascript gets all the power it needs to create dynamic html. The third video in our javascript basics tutorial series. In fact, the web browser creates a dom of the webpage when the page is loaded. Javascript dom object tutorial to learn javascript dom object in simple, easy and step by step way with syntax, examples and notes. The w3c dom standard is separated into 3 different parts. It defines the logical structure of documents and the way a.
Add, delete, or modify elements in the xml document. The the key to all those cool javascript and ajax affects is found in understanding what the document object model is in short, we call this the dom. Javascript object functions are a bit like java methods they have arguments and return values a function is a firstclass object in javascript unlike in java can be considered as a descendant of object can do everything a regular javascript object can do such as storing properties by name. In this tutorial ill explain exactly what the dom is document object model and how. Umls basic constructs, rules and diagram techniques. The document object model dom connects web pages to scripts or programming languages by representing the structure of a. A document object represents the html document that is displayed in that window. The html dom defines a standard way for accessing and manipulating html documents. This page lists tutorials designed to teach you all the concepts and practical techniques youll need to know to do dom manipulation. This lesson presents the document object model dom. Dom intro dom methods dom document dom elements dom html dom css dom animations dom events dom event listener dom navigation dom nodes dom.
The term document is used for any markupbased resource, ranging from short static documents to long. This example takes an xml document example 2 that marks up an article and uses the dom api to display the documents element names and values. Accessing the attributes on the page object instance accesses the live elements on the page, thus removing the need for your test code to worry about how to. In this excerpt from the javascript for wordpress master course, educator, zac gordon, introduces the document object model, an api we can use with javascript in interact with the browser view the.
Covers topics like what is dom, dom object, element object and anchor object, various properties and methods of these objects etc. Document library a document is formed basing on a tree structure. Document object model javascript basics tutorial 3 youtube. This crash course focuses on the dom without jquery. Document object model tutorial pdf archives education. Javascript html dom w3schools online web tutorials. Using dom functions lets you create nodes, remove nodes, change their contents, and traverse the node hierarchy. The tutorial is divided into sections such as xml dom basics, xml dom operations and xml dom objects. On the next page we consider a small xml document with. Its children represent the entire xml document except the xml declaration. This is a 70page long pdf document that serves as a detailed manual for the sketcher workbench.
Well look at how the dom represents an html or xml document in memory and how you use apis to create web content and applications what is the dom. For me, understanding com component object model has been no less than an odyssey. What you will learn what the uml is and what is it not. It is an interface that allows a programming language to manipulate the content, structure, and style of a website.
A database system that supports an object oriented data model would eliminate this impedance mismatch and furnish the desired modeling capabilities. In this video ill be discussing the document object model, or dom, and giving examples of how it can be used. The document object model dom is a programming interface. The html dom document object model when a web page is loaded, the browser creates a document object model of the page. The document object model dom is a programming interface for html and xml documents. The dom is essentially an application programming interfaceapi used for html and xml documents, it represents the document as a hierarchical tree consisting of nodes.
The document object has various properties that refer to other objects which allow access to and modification of document content. This course is adapted to your level as well as all dom pdf courses to better enrich your knowledge. The document object model is not used to describe objects in xml or html whereas the dom describes xml and html documents as objects. The two most common types of nodes are element nodes and text nodes. The browser is an object,and the document it displays is an object too. This tutorial will teach you the basics of xml dom. All you need to do is download the training document, open it and start learning dom for free. Standing on the shoulders of scriptographer and making use of html5 standards, paper. As a w3c specification, one important objective for the document object model is to provide a standard programming interface that can be used in a wide variety of. Javascript can access all the elements in a webpage making use of document object model dom. It defines the logical structure of documents and the way a document is accessed and manipulated. Tag archives for document object model tutorial pdf. How to work with the dom tree and nodes digitalocean.
927 837 1153 1324 409 1092 426 375 904 34 650 545 963 515 984 1496 538 761 364 1217 900 784 357 788 987 917 993 688 549 503